Annelisse
an-eh-LEES
Annelisse is a girl’s name of Germanic origin, meaning “Annelisse is a composite name combining Anna (Hebrew for "grace") and Lise (a diminutive of Elizabeth, meaning "pledged to God").”. It currently ranks #11157 in the US, and peaked in popularity in 2008.
What Annelisse Means
“Annelisse is a composite name combining Anna (Hebrew for "grace") and Lise (a diminutive of Elizabeth, meaning "pledged to God").”

Annelisse is a sophisticated Germanic composite, marrying Anna (Hebrew for 'grace') with Lise (a diminutive of Elizabeth, meaning 'pledged to God'). First appearing around 2005, it offers a modern, elegant interpretation of devotion and favor.
